El Azteca Mexican Cocina
If you haven't found El Azteca Mexican Cocina yet, you're missing out on one of Bushnell's best-kept secrets — though with a 4.7-star Google rating and a loyal following, the secret is getting out fast. Tucked into Bushnell Plaza off SR 48, this family-run spot serves authentic Mexican cuisine that goes well beyond the typical Tex-Mex playbook. The enchiladas are rich and saucy, the fajitas come out sizzling, and the tamales taste like someone's abuela made them that morning. Don't skip the sangria — regulars call it spectacular, and they're not exaggerating. What sets El Azteca apart isn't just the food, though. It's the warmth. Reviewers consistently rave about the staff — attentive, genuine, the kind of service that makes you feel like family from the first visit. The dining room is clean and inviting, the kind of place you'd bring your parents or take the kids on a Tuesday night just as easily as a Friday date night. Portions are generous, prices are fair, and the fresh, thin tortillas alone are worth the trip. Whether you're stopping in for a quick lunch combo, ordering takeout through Toast or DoorDash, or settling in for a full dinner with margaritas, El Azteca delivers every time. It's the kind of neighborhood restaurant that makes you glad you live here — and if you're visiting the area, it's reason enough to get off the interstate.
